Intracisternal delivery of PEG-coated gold nanoparticles results in high brain penetrance and long-lasting stability.

Antonello SpinelliMaria GirelliDaniela ArosioLaura PolitoPaola PodiniGianvito MartinoPierfausto SeneciLuca MuzioAndrea Menegon
Published in: Journal of nanobiotechnology (2019)
Our results suggest that the ICM route for delivering gold particles allows the targeting of neurons. This approach might be pursued to carry therapeutics or diagnostics inside a diseased brain with a surgical procedure that is largely used in gene therapy approaches. Furthermore, this approach could be used for radiotherapy, enhancing the agent's efficacy to kill brain cancer cells.
